Background
Geological disasters are unfavorable geological phenomena which are formed under the action of natural geological effects or human factors and cause damage and loss to human life and property and environment, such as soil salinization, people timely treat the soil salinization through physical improvement, water conservancy improvement, chemical improvement and biological improvement, wherein the chemical improvement is to put soil conditioners such as gypsum, phosphogypsum, calcium superphosphate, humic acid, peat, vinegar residue and the like into mixing equipment to be mixed with water, the mixing equipment is directly connected with an irrigation system, the mixed agents are sprayed into the soil through the irrigation system to treat the saline-alkali soil, however, the conditioner mixing equipment in the prior art only can simply mix the conditioner with the water, when the conditioner particles are large, the conditioner particles cannot be quickly dissolved, and the water pump is easily damaged by the undissolved conditioner particles, the efficiency and the progress of soil salinization treatment are influenced, and for the purpose, an ecological environment treatment device for geological disasters is provided.

The stirring device 2 further comprises a stirring motor 16, a rotating drum 17, a rotating shaft 18 and a protective shell 19, wherein the motor 16 is connected with a power supply, the rotating drum 17 penetrates through the top of the stirring box 1 and is connected with the box wall of the stirring box 1 through a bearing, a plurality of first stirring knives 4 are uniformly fixed on the outer wall of the bottom end part of the rotating drum 17, the rotating shaft 18 penetrates through the rotating drum 17 and is connected with the inner wall of the rotating drum 17 through a bearing, a plurality of second stirring knives 5 are uniformly fixed at the bottom end part of the rotating shaft 18, a conical gear ring 20 is fixedly arranged at the upper end of the rotating drum 17, a first conical gear 21 is fixedly arranged at the upper end of the rotating shaft 18, the first conical gear 21 is positioned above the conical gear ring 20, the stirring motor 16 is fixed at the upper side of the stirring box 1, the output shaft end of the stirring motor 16 is connected with a second conical gear 22, and the second conical gear 22 is respectively, the protective shell 19 is fixed on the upper side of the stirring box 1, the conical gear ring 20, the first conical gear 21 and the second conical gear 22 are all located in the protective shell 19, and the protective shell 19 is used for protecting the cooperation work of the conical gear ring 20, the first conical gear 21 and the second conical gear 22 from being influenced by the outside.
The grinding device 3 comprises a motor 23, a grinding disc 24 and a guide plate 25, the motor 23 is fixed on the inner wall of the stirring box 1 and is connected with a power supply, a rotating shaft of the grinding disc 24 is connected with the box wall of the stirring box 1 through a bearing, the motor 23 is in transmission connection with the grinding disc 24 through a transmission belt device 26, the guide plate 25 is positioned under the grinding disc 24, the guide plate 25 is fixed on the inner wall of the stirring box 1, and the guide plate 25 inclines downwards from left to right.
The water feeding pipe orifice 6 is connected with a water pump, a water flow control valve is connected between the water feeding pipe orifice 6 and the water pump, the water feeding pipe orifice 7 is connected with a medicine feeding source, a medicine feeding control valve is connected between the water feeding pipe orifice and the medicine feeding source, the water flow control valve and the medicine feeding control valve are both in the prior art, the bottom of the stirring box 1 is gradually sunken from the periphery to the middle, and the lower end of the connecting cylinder 10 is connected with a feeding pipe.
When the utility model is implemented, the whole device is respectively connected with a water source connected with a water pump, a conditioner feeding source and a feeding pipe, the stirring motor 16 and the motor 23 are started, the whole device can start to operate, the speed of drug administration and the flow of water are adjusted by adjusting the drug administration control valve and the water flow control valve, the conditioner drug falls onto the grinding device 3 for primary grinding after coming out from the drug adding pipe orifice 7 and then falls into the stirring box 1 to be mixed with water, under the bidirectional stirring action of the stirring device 2, the conditioner medicine can be fully mixed with water, and under the action of the first stirring knife 4 and the second stirring knife 5 with opposite stirring directions, the conditioner medicine can be secondarily stirred and crushed while being mixed with the water, and then make the mixer medicine can fully dissolve to the aquatic, carry out and spray the subaerial of need administering through the conveying pipe at last can.
It is worth mentioning that when the conditioner drug and the water just start to enter the stirring box 1, because the amount of the conditioner drug and the water is small, the conditioner drug and the water cannot be effectively mixed and dissolved at the beginning, and the telescopic rod 13 on the control valve 9 does not extend under the elastic force of the spring 14 at the moment, so the piston sheet 12 can be always tightly attached to the limiting ring 11, thereby ensuring that the mixed liquid of the conditioner drug and the water does not flow out of the stirring box 1 at the moment, when the amount of the conditioner drug and the water in the stirring box 1 gradually increases, the mixture of the conditioner drug and the water in the stirring box 1 becomes more sufficient until the conditioner drug is completely dissolved, the mixture of the conditioner drug and the water in the stirring box 1 also reaches a certain amount, the pressure of the mixed liquid becomes greater than the elastic force of the spring 14 at the moment, the telescopic rod 13 extends, and the piston sheet 12 moves downwards along with the mixed liquid, the mixed liquid can be smoothly conveyed away after passing through the control valve 9.
